Taxonomy Code 106E00000X
Display Name Assistant Behavior Analyst
Taxonomy Group Behavioral Health & Social Service Providers
Taxonomy Classification Assistant Behavior Analyst
Definition An assistant behavior analyst is qualified by Behavior Analyst Certification Board certification and/or a state-issued license or credential in behavior analysis to practice under the supervision of an appropriately credentialed professional behavior analyst. An assistant behavior analyst delivers services consistent with the dimensions of applied behavior analysis and supervision requirements defined in state laws or regulations and/or national certification standards. Common services may include, but are not limited to, conducting behavioral assessments, analyzing data, writing behavior-analytic treatment plans, training and supervising others in implementation of components of treatment plans, and direct implementation of treatment plans.
Effective Date September 30, 2009
